Black Sesame - A Nutty Delight:


Black sesame seeds are small, oval-shaped seeds with a rich, nutty flavor and a striking dark color. These seeds are commonly used in Asian cuisines, particularly in Japanese, Chinese, and Korean dishes. Apart from their culinary appeal, black sesame seeds are known for their numerous health benefits.


They are a good source of healthy fats, protein, fiber, and essential minerals like calcium, iron, and magnesium. Additionally, black sesame seeds contain antioxidants that help protect cells from damage caused by free radicals.


Purple Sweet Potato - A Vibrant Nutrient Powerhouse:


The purple sweet potato, also known as the Okinawan sweet potato, is a stunningly vibrant root vegetable that hails from Okinawa, Japan. Its deep purple color is not only visually appealing but also indicative of its high antioxidant content, particularly anthocyanins.


These antioxidants are renowned for their potential to combat oxidative stress and inflammation in the body. Purple sweet potatoes are also rich in dietary fiber, vitamins, and minerals, such as vitamin C, vitamin A, potassium, and manganese.

Culinary Delights with Black Sesame and Purple Sweet Potato:


The versatility of both black sesame and purple sweet potato allows for a wide range of culinary creations. Here are some delectable ways in which these two ingredients can be combined:


a. Black Sesame and Purple Sweet Potato Desserts: From ice creams and puddings to cakes and mochi, the combination of black sesame and purple sweet potato creates indulgent desserts with contrasting textures and flavors.


b. Savory Dishes: In savory dishes, black sesame, and purple sweet potato can be used to create innovative dishes like purple sweet potato gnocchi topped with a black sesame pesto or roasted purple sweet potato wedges sprinkled with black sesame seeds.


c. Beverages: The combination of black sesame and purple sweet potato can also be explored in beverages like smoothies, lattes, and milkshakes, adding depth and character to these drinks.
